Transaction 15b1b5c950393a5622c846a73243d79abec17d62b057930e5e0b7f3be3c76da3
1 Input
1 Output
-
15b1b5c950393a5622c846a73243d79abec17d62b057930e5e0b7f3be3c76da3:0
- value
- 133700
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a66f7629c01ff682856125749e347507f9d882d
- address
- bc1qrfn0wc5uq8lks2zkzft5nc682plemzpdzfaxyv